Explorar o código

Merge pull request #21 from Geertvdc/master

Changed iOS build settings to default to x64 so iOS 10.1 won't give warnings on boot
James Montemagno %!s(int64=9) %!d(string=hai) anos
pai
achega
cb739de5f0

+ 2 - 3
Demos/app-imagesearch-cogs/ImageSearch/ImageSearch.iOS/Entitlements.plist

@@ -1,6 +1,5 @@
-<?xml version="1.0" encoding="UTF-8" ?>
+<?xml version="1.0" encoding="UTF-8"?>
 <!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d">
 <plist version="1.0">
-<dict>
-</dict>
+<dict/>
 </plist>

+ 31 - 5
Demos/app-imagesearch-cogs/ImageSearch/ImageSearch.iOS/ImageSearch.iOS.csproj

@@ -21,10 +21,22 @@
     <ErrorReport>prompt</ErrorReport>
     <WarningLevel>4</WarningLevel>
     <ConsolePause>false</ConsolePause>
-    <MtouchArch>i386</MtouchArch>
+    <MtouchArch>x86_64</MtouchArch>
     <MtouchLink>None</MtouchLink>
-    <MtouchDebug>true</MtouchDebug>
-    <MtouchProfiling>true</MtouchProfiling>
+    <MtouchDebug>True</MtouchDebug>
+    <MtouchProfiling>False</MtouchProfiling>
+    <MtouchSdkVersion>10.1</MtouchSdkVersion>
+    <MtouchFastDev>False</MtouchFastDev>
+    <MtouchUseLlvm>False</MtouchUseLlvm>
+    <MtouchUseThumb>False</MtouchUseThumb>
+    <MtouchEnableBitcode>False</MtouchEnableBitcode>
+    <MtouchUseSGen>False</MtouchUseSGen>
+    <MtouchUseRefCounting>False</MtouchUseRefCounting>
+    <OptimizePNGs>True</OptimizePNGs>
+    <MtouchTlsProvider>Default</MtouchTlsProvider>
+    <MtouchHttpClientHandler>HttpClientHandler</MtouchHttpClientHandler>
+    <MtouchFloat32>False</MtouchFloat32>
+    <PlatformTarget>x64</PlatformTarget>
   </PropertyGroup>
   <PropertyGroup Condition=" '$(Configuration)|$(Platform)' == 'Release|iPhone' ">
     <DebugType>full</DebugType>
@@ -58,9 +70,23 @@
     <ConsolePause>false</ConsolePause>
     <MtouchArch>ARMv7, ARM64</MtouchArch>
     <CodesignEntitlements>Entitlements.plist</CodesignEntitlements>
-    <MtouchProfiling>true</MtouchProfiling>
+    <MtouchProfiling>False</MtouchProfiling>
     <CodesignKey>iPhone Developer</CodesignKey>
-    <MtouchDebug>true</MtouchDebug>
+    <MtouchDebug>True</MtouchDebug>
+    <PlatformTarget>x64</PlatformTarget>
+    <MtouchSdkVersion>10.1</MtouchSdkVersion>
+    <MtouchLink>SdkOnly</MtouchLink>
+    <MtouchFastDev>False</MtouchFastDev>
+    <MtouchUseLlvm>False</MtouchUseLlvm>
+    <MtouchUseThumb>False</MtouchUseThumb>
+    <MtouchEnableBitcode>False</MtouchEnableBitcode>
+    <MtouchUseSGen>False</MtouchUseSGen>
+    <MtouchUseRefCounting>False</MtouchUseRefCounting>
+    <OptimizePNGs>True</OptimizePNGs>
+    <MtouchTlsProvider>Default</MtouchTlsProvider>
+    <MtouchHttpClientHandler>HttpClientHandler</MtouchHttpClientHandler>
+    <MtouchFloat32>False</MtouchFloat32>
+    <DeviceSpecificBuild>False</DeviceSpecificBuild>
   </PropertyGroup>
   <ItemGroup>
     <Reference Include="Acr.Support.iOS, Version=1.0.0.0, Culture=neutral, processorArchitecture=MSIL">

+ 4 - 4
Demos/app-imagesearch-cogs/ImageSearch/ImageSearch.iOS/Info.plist

@@ -1,4 +1,4 @@
-<?xml version="1.0" encoding="UTF-8"?>
+<?xml version="1.0" encoding="UTF-8"?>
 <!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d">
 <plist version="1.0">
 <dict>
@@ -13,7 +13,7 @@
 	<key>LSRequiresIPhoneOS</key>
 	<true/>
 	<key>MinimumOSVersion</key>
-	<string>8.1</string>
+	<string>9.1</string>
 	<key>UIDeviceFamily</key>
 	<array>
 		<integer>1</integer>
@@ -46,7 +46,7 @@
 	<string>Resources/Images.xcassets/AppIcons.appiconset</string>
 	<key>XSLaunchImageAssets</key>
 	<string>Resources/Images.xcassets/LaunchImage.launchimage</string>
-  <key>NSLocationWhenInUseUsageDescription</key>
-  <string>Location to get photos nearby.</string>
+	<key>NSLocationWhenInUseUsageDescription</key>
+	<string>Location to get photos nearby.</string>
 </dict>
 </plist>

+ 4 - 1
Demos/app-myweather/MyWeather.iOS/MyWeather.iOS.csproj

@@ -21,10 +21,12 @@
     <ErrorReport>prompt</ErrorReport>
     <WarningLevel>4</WarningLevel>
     <ConsolePause>false</ConsolePause>
-    <MtouchArch>i386</MtouchArch>
+    <MtouchArch>x86_64</MtouchArch>
     <MtouchLink>None</MtouchLink>
     <MtouchDebug>true</MtouchDebug>
     <MtouchProfiling>true</MtouchProfiling>
+<MtouchHttpClientHandler>HttpClientHandler</MtouchHttpClientHandler>
+<CodesignKey>iPhone Developer</CodesignKey>
   </PropertyGroup>
   <PropertyGroup Condition=" '$(Configuration)|$(Platform)' == 'Release|iPhone' ">
     <DebugType>full</DebugType>
@@ -128,6 +130,7 @@
   <ItemGroup>
     <ProjectReference Include="..\MyWeather\MyWeather.csproj">
       <Name>MyWeather</Name>
+      <Project>{5366CC83-65A3-4969-B883-3229108447E2}</Project>
     </ProjectReference>
   </ItemGroup>
   <ItemGroup>

+ 1 - 1
Demos/app-tasks/DevDaysTasks.iOS/DevDaysTasks.iOS.csproj

@@ -21,7 +21,7 @@
     <ErrorReport>prompt</ErrorReport>
     <WarningLevel>4</WarningLevel>
     <ConsolePause>false</ConsolePause>
-    <MtouchArch>i386</MtouchArch>
+    <MtouchArch>x86_64</MtouchArch>
     <MtouchLink>None</MtouchLink>
     <MtouchDebug>true</MtouchDebug>
     <MtouchProfiling>true</MtouchProfiling>